1. Leverage User-Generated Content (UGC)
UGC, or user-generated content, has seen a meteoric rise in popularity over recent years. This model diverges from traditional influencer marketing by focusing on content creation for brands rather than promoting products to your audience. High-quality, engaging UGC can attract brands looking for your particular aesthetic or style, offering a lucrative opportunity without the pressure of achieving high viewership numbers. Establishing yourself as a UGC creator involves showcasing your capability in your bio and portfolio, paving the way for brand collaborations.
2. Promote Your Services Through Content
Highlighting your professional services via YouTube can significantly enhance your visibility and attract clients. Real estate agents, for example, can gain clients through comprehensive tours and comparisons of properties, as viewers appreciate the insight and may prefer your personality as a result. Similarly, wedding planners can offer valuable tips on organizing weddings, subtly promoting their services. This method not only showcases your expertise but also organically grows your client base.
3. Merchandise and Product Sales
YouTube has relaxed its subscriber requirements for linking merchandise directly below videos, opening a new revenue stream for creators with even a modest following. This change allows you to introduce brand merchandise or link to products on your ecommerce site earlier in your YouTube journey. 4. Utilize Affiliate Marketing
While affiliate marketing is well-trodden territory, repurposing YouTube content into blog posts for affiliate purposes is a less common strategy. By converting video content into written form, you can attract a new audience through search engines and insert affiliate links in your posts. 5. Secure Brand Deals and Sponsorships
Contrary to popular belief, securing brand deals does not require a massive subscriber count. The creator economy’s growth has increased interest in nano and micro-influencers, proving that even creators with a few thousand subscribers can land lucrative brand partnerships. These deals may not be enormous in monetary terms but represent an important additional income stream and motivation to continue growing your channel.
